fix(feed): load pictures via object_pairs instead of sentence UUID heuristic

Pictures are now fetched through the canonical pair→object relationship
(object_pairs table) rather than by guessing objects from sentence
placeholder UUIDs. Removes the word→object indirect lookup hack added
previously. One query covers all pairs in the batch.
